Hans Kann, the esteemed Austrian pianist and composer, left an indelible mark on the classical music world. Born in Vienna in 1927, Kann's musical journey began in his native city, where he later became a prominent figure in its rich musical tapestry. His career spanned decades, during which he not only captivated audiences with his virtuosic performances but also inspired generations of musicians as a dedicated pedagogue. Kann's compositions, characterized by their depth and emotional resonance, continue to enchant listeners worldwide. His legacy endures through his recordings, which offer a glimpse into the soul of a true musical maestro.
